OK, I bought the Diprocol gauges a couple weeks back and I NEED to install them, but I don't know how long of a pressure hose do I need to have made for the truck? I am runnig this gauge in the A pillar pod in my truck, but I can't install all 3 gauges til I have all the parts. What is the length on the pressure line, and where do I attach it to?

You can attach it on top of the fuel filter housing. There are two brass plugs, remove the one closet to the front of the engine, this is your outlet side of your fuel filter housing. I used some nylon type hydraulic hose with regular compression fittings. I think they were 1/8 NPT.
If I had to guess, you would need at least 7 feet.
